Animal care and/or cleaning device
11528889 · 2022-12-20 · ·

An animal care or cleaning device has a brush (2) mounted on a brush shaft (16), drivable by an electric motor drive (36) to rotate the brush (2). The brush shaft is rotatably mounted in a bearing (14) provided on a support (4, 6), and has an actuator by which the drive (36) can be actuated as a function of contact of the brush (2) with an animal body. The bearing (14) has at least one shaft bearing (14) that holds the axis of rotation of the brush (2) in a fixed positional relationship to the support (4, 6). The drive (36) is driven by torque acting on the brush shaft (16) in one or other direction of rotation, caused by an impact motion of the animal body on the brush (2), and is carried along at most to a predeterminable dead stop on the support (4, 6). The drive triggers the actuator (42) for actuating the drive (36) during this motion.

BODY CLEANSER
20220395086 · 2022-12-15 · ·

A skin cleaner includes a case configured to form an accommodation space therein; a bracket configured to be accommodated in the accommodation space; a rotor configured to be rotatably disposed on the bracket; a rotation mechanism configured to be accommodated in the accommodation space and to rotate the rotor; an ultrasonic head configured to be disposed on the bracket and having a built-in ultrasonic vibrator therein; a vibration motor configured to be accommodated in the accommodation space and to vibrate the bracket; a plurality of brush units having magnets disposed on a surface facing the case and configured to be selectively disposed on the rotor; and a sensor configured to be accommodated in the accommodation space and to detect the magnet.

BRUSH FOR AUTONOMOUS CLEANING ROBOT
20220395154 · 2022-12-15 ·

An autonomous cleaning robot includes a drive system to move the autonomous cleaning robot about a floor surface, a cleaning head on a bottom portion of the autonomous cleaning robot, a side brush on the bottom portion of the autonomous cleaning robot, and a vacuum system in pneumatic communication with the opening. The cleaning head is configured to direct debris from the floor surface into the autonomous cleaning robot as the autonomous cleaning robot moves about the floor surface. The side brush is rotatable about a rotational axis forming a non-zero angle with a floor surface, and the side brush comprising an opening.

SCRUBBER WITH NON-CIRCULAR BRUSH HEAD
20220378270 · 2022-12-01 ·

A brush head including a central portion centered respective to a rotation axis, an attachment feature configured to secure the brush head for rotation about the rotation axis, and a plurality of lobes. The plurality of lobes extend radially outwardly from the central portion and the rotation axis. At least one lobe extends along a curvilinear path, the curvilinear path extending through the central portion. The lobe has varying widths along the curvilinear path, the varying widths being perpendicular to the curvilinear path.

FLUID DISPENSING SCRUBBER
20220369801 · 2022-11-24 ·

A fluid dispensing scrubber includes a shaft having a first end and a second end; a fluid inlet configured to receive a first fluid from an external source; a reservoir configured to store a second fluid; a valve assembly configured to selectively mix the first fluid and the second fluid; a scrubbing head supported adjacent the first end of the shaft, the scrubbing head including a brush and a motor operable to rotate the brush; a battery pack supported adjacent the second end, the battery pack operable to provide power to the motor; and a dispensing nozzle configured to selectively dispense one or both of the first fluid and the second fluid, the nozzle supported on an exterior surface of the scrubbing head.

Rotary brush and rotary brush wire configurations

A rotary wire brush, such as a wheel brush, e.g., double-stringer or dually brush, cup brush, bevel brush, or knotted end brush, composed of knotted brush wire tufts of multistrand construction each having at least a plurality of brush wire strands, preferably at least a plurality of pairs of, i.e., at least three, strands each formed of at least a plurality, preferably at least a plurality of pairs of, i.e., at least three, wires. The wires forming strands are twisted, braided, or twisted and braided, and the strands that form tufts are twisted, braided, or twisted and braided. A preferred brush employs a center disc, e.g., hub, with radially offset tuft anchor holes, which can have different sizes, from which twist knot tufts, which also can have different sizes, can outwardly extend from the disc different distances by being configured with an offset trim preferably having different trim lengths.

Customizable cleaning brush
11503964 · 2022-11-22 ·

A customizable cleaning brush, including a main body, a plurality of head members removably connected to at least a portion of the main body to brush, scrub, and massage a body of a user, a plurality of operation controls disposed on at least a portion of a first side of the main body to perform at least one of a rotation, oscillation, and vibration of the plurality of head members, and a plurality of pressure controls disposed on at least a portion of a second side of the main body to perform at least one of a speed control and a pressure control of the plurality of head members.

SEGMENTS FOR ARRANGING ON AND FOR FORMING A DISC BRUSH

A segment for detachably arranging on a carrier, which can be rotatably mounted relative to an axis of rotation, for forming a disc brush or for forming a cleaning, grinding or polishing disc, includes a segment body, wherein multiple bristles protrude from the underside thereof or an abrasive grit and/or a fiber structure is arranged on the underside thereof, wherein the segment body has a segment guide extending in the radial direction in relation to the axis of rotation of the carrier on a radially internal edge and spaced apart from an external—in relation to a circumferential direction—lateral edge of the segment body, which segment guide is designed to cooperate with a corresponding carrier guide formed or arranged on the carrier for arranging the segment on the carrier.

Interchangeable-Tool Machine Interface for a Cleaning Brush
20230058414 · 2023-02-23 ·

An interchangeable-tool machine interface for a cleaning brush, includes a drive interface and output interface that are separable and connectable without tools and are separable or connectable in several discrete angular positions by axial displacement along a common axis of rotation. The output interface has centering walls and resiliently displaceable latching-means walls, the centering walls and the resiliently displaceable latching means walls are arranged so as to be angularly offset from one another in the circumferential direction about the axis of rotation. The drive interface has centering and mating latching-means walls that are arranged so as to be angularly offset from one another in the circumferential direction about the axis of rotation and, per wall, are designed to correspond both to the centering walls and to the latching means walls of the output interface.
